For AirPods (including AirPods 4), Lost Mode in Find My doesn’t “lock” the case the way Activation Lock works on an iPhone or iPad. Instead, it’s more of a "tracker and notification system" for whoever finds it. When you put your case into Lost Mode, you can add a custom message and phone number or email so that if someone else with an iPhone brings it near their device, they’ll see your contact info pop up. It also lets you track its last known location and get notified if it’s found or comes back online.
As for compatibility — unfortunately, the AirPods case itself isn’t permanently tied to your Apple Account. That means someone else could pair your lost case with their own AirPods if they reset it, and Find My won’t stop them.
